Artist(s): Mbolele Sabulon (Composer/Performer)Meru men (Performer) | Composer: Mbolele Sabulon (Composer/Performer)Meru men (Performer) | 1950/10/02 | Chaga, dance, East African, Embrukoi, Mbolele Sabulon, men and women, Meru, Meru, Retrieving lost cattle, Song, Tanganyika, Tanzania, Wembe side blown horn, ILAM | Embrukoi dance song for men and women about how to retrieve lost cattle. The song is performed by 600 men and women and accompanied by a side blown horn. Refer ILAM field card D7C8
